Cloning your voice with AI means recording samples of your speech, uploading them to a voice-cloning platform, and letting a neural network learn the acoustic fingerprint of your voice so it can generate new speech from any text you type. The entire process can take as little as 15 minutes of recording and a few minutes of processing time, though quality improves substantially with 30 minutes to an hour of clean audio. What Voice Cloning Actually Is

Voice cloning, sometimes called audio deepfake synthesis or neural text-to-speech personalization, is the process of training or fine-tuning a machine learning model on recordings of a specific person's voice. The model learns characteristics like pitch range, timbre, cadence, accent, and breathing patterns, then uses that profile to synthesize speech for text the person never actually spoke aloud.
The technology has moved fast. In early 2023, platforms like 15.ai demonstrated that convincing character voices could be cloned with as little as 15 seconds of reference audio — the name itself referenced that threshold. By late 2023, commercial services like ElevenLabs had brought professional-grade instant cloning to mainstream creators, and Wired reported that same year on how easily podcast hosts' voices could be replicated. As of 2026, most consumer platforms offer two tiers: instant cloning (roughly 1–5 minutes of audio, results in under a minute) and professional cloning (30 minutes to several hours of audio, trained over hours, producing noticeably higher fidelity).
It's worth being clear-eyed about what cloning is not. A clone reproduces how you sound, not how you think. It won't improvise jokes, adjust tone contextually without direction, or capture emotional depth beyond what your training samples contained. If your source recordings are flat and monotone, your clone will be too.
Why People Clone Their Voices
The use cases have expanded well beyond novelty. Audiobook narration is one of the biggest drivers: converting ebooks into audio using your own cloned voice lets authors produce narrated editions at a fraction of studio costs. Content creators use clones to fix flubbed lines in podcasts and videos without re-recording sessions, a workflow popularized by tools like Descript since around 2022.
Dubbing and translation represent another major category. Tools in the vein of Shook, which appeared on Hacker News demonstrating real-time voice translation across languages, let you speak English and output Spanish, Japanese, or French while retaining your vocal identity. Accessibility is perhaps the most moving application: WBUR reported the story of a woman who lost her voice to cancer and reconstructed it using AI trained on old recordings. For people facing throat surgery, ALS, or degenerative conditions, banking a voice clone before losing speech has become a genuine medical-adjacent practice.
There are also legitimate commercial reasons: game developers and studios now negotiate AI voice rights explicitly (Hasbro's contracts with child voice actors regarding AI usage drew scrutiny from The Hollywood Reporter), and enterprises listed by Voices.com among top AI voice companies in 2026 increasingly build cloned-voice workflows into customer service and e-learning production.
Step-by-Step: How to Clone Your Voice
Step 1: Choose your platform. Pick a reputable service such as ElevenLabs, Resemble AI, PlayHT, Descript, or clonemyvoice.io. Verify the platform requires voice ownership consent — legitimate services do; sketchy ones don't.
Step 2: Record your training audio. Use a quiet room, a decent USB or XLR microphone, and speak naturally for 10–60 minutes depending on whether you want instant or professional quality. Read varied material: conversational passages, questions, exclamations, numbers, and technical terms you commonly use. Keep consistent mic distance (about 15–20 cm) and avoid background noise, reverb-heavy rooms, or music underneath your speech.
Step 3: Clean and upload. Trim silence, remove breaths if excessive, and export as WAV or high-bitrate MP3 (44.1 kHz minimum). Most platforms accept multiple files totaling your target duration.
Step 4: Train the model. Instant clones process in seconds to minutes. Professional clones may take several hours. You'll typically verify the voice matches by listening to generated test sentences.
Step 5: Generate and refine. Type text, generate speech, and iterate. Adjust stability/similarity settings where offered — higher similarity settings sound more like you but can introduce artifacts; lower settings are smoother but more generic. Save your best settings per project type.
Step 6: Post-process. Light EQ, compression, and de-essing in an editor like Audacity (free) or Adobe Podcast Enhance closes the gap between raw AI output and broadcast-quality audio.
Choosing a Platform: Comparison
| Feature | Instant Cloning | Professional Cloning |
|---|---|---|
| Training audio needed | 1–5 minutes | 30 minutes – 3 hours |
| Setup time | Under 5 minutes | Several hours to train |
| Quality ceiling | Good for casual content | Near-indistinguishable from real speech |
| Typical cost | Often included in $5–$22/month plans | Premium tiers, roughly $22–$99+/month |
| Best for | Social videos, drafts, prototyping | Audiobooks, dubbing, client work |
| Emotional range | Limited | Strong, if source audio varies |
Common Mistakes That Ruin Clone Quality
The single biggest error is bad source audio. Room echo, HVAC hum, keyboard clicks, and phone-recorded audio all get baked into your clone permanently. Record in a closet full of clothes or a treated room before blaming the software. Second, people record too little and too monotonously — five minutes of flat reading produces a flat clone. Vary your delivery deliberately during training recordings.
Third, mismatched expectations about emotion. If you need an excited promotional read, include energetic samples in training; a clone trained only on calm narration will struggle to sound excited convincingly. Fourth, ignoring pronunciation edge cases: names, acronyms, and brand terms often come out wrong. Most platforms support phonetic spelling overrides or custom dictionaries — use them rather than regenerating endlessly.
Finally, many users skip consent and legal review entirely. Cloning someone else's voice without permission is illegal in a growing number of jurisdictions, and even cloning your own voice for certain commercial uses can conflict with union agreements (SAG-AFTRA has negotiated specific AI consent frameworks since 2023). The KSL.com report on experts warning against using an AI clone of a murdered woman's voice in court illustrates how ethically fraught unauthorized cloning becomes once it leaves the studio.
Costs, Timing, and When to Start
Budget-wise, expect free tiers sufficient for experimentation, roughly $5–$22 per month for hobbyist plans with instant cloning, and $22–$99+ per month for professional-grade output and commercial licenses. One-time audiobook projects can also be priced per finished hour through some marketplaces. Time investment breaks down as: 30–60 minutes recording, minutes-to-hours training, then ongoing generation time measured in seconds per sentence.
When should you act? If there's any chance you'll lose your voice — scheduled surgery, a progressive diagnosis — bank a high-quality clone now using months of varied recordings; retroactive reconstruction from old voicemails works (as the WBUR story showed) but yields lower fidelity. Content creators should clone proactively too: having your voice model ready means fixing a mispronounced word at 11 p.m. before a deadline instead of booking studio time. There's no downside to banking a private clone you control, provided the platform offers deletion rights and doesn't train shared models on your data without opt-in.
Ethics, Law, and Protecting Your Voice
The same technology that restores voices also enables fraud. The FTC has warned about family-emergency scams using cloned voices since 2023, and researchers at the University of Cincinnati and publications like Nautilus have documented both the power and danger of accessible cloning. Defenses exist: many banks and platforms now use liveness detection and challenge questions, and watermarking standards for synthetic audio are maturing through industry coalitions.
Legally, the picture is patchy. BBC reporting noted UK law may not stop someone cloning your voice, while Australian copyright scholars have debated whether voices qualify for protection under existing frameworks. In the US, state right-of-publicity laws (Tennessee's ELVIS Act of 2024 being a landmark) increasingly cover voice likeness. Practically: never clone anyone without written consent, keep records of your own consent when working with clients, and read platform terms to confirm you retain ownership of your voice model and can delete it. Voice actors negotiating AI clauses in 2026 should demand scope limits, duration caps, and per-use compensation rather than blanket perpetual rights — the Hasbro contract controversy shows why vague language favors studios.
Used responsibly, voice cloning is a practical production tool and, for some, a way to preserve identity itself. Used carelessly, it erodes trust in audio entirely. The difference lies almost entirely in consent, disclosure, and source-data quality.
